You Can Feel It
Your sense organ for feeling is your skin. It helps you identify the texture, hotness, or coldness of objects in your surroundings.

How Does it Taste?
Your tongue is your sense organ for tasting; it helps you identify the taste of objects you eat.
Different tastes:
- sweet
- sour
- bitter
- salty
- spicy

Language Arts Prep
Vowels and Consonants
What are vowels: A E I O U
What are consonants: B C D F G H J K L M N P Q R S T V W X Y Z
